Good Points

Nice board and it was cheap aswell. Liked the Raid Controller.


Bad Points

Had A Radeon 9000 Pro and it failed to work. Maybe the power consumption of both the board AND the card. Now running a Palomina Athlon XP 2000+ which is the MAX for this board. Very stable board. Don't understand the low ratings :o).
Also have a 512 MB single DDR chip PC2100 No probs. Am running BIOS 1.8 and 1.9. Only lack is that it doesn't support Thoroughbred Athlon's guess this board is on it's way for the End of Live cycle.


General Comments

I have this board since the first introduction of the board and then in combination with an Athlon Palomino XP 1500 and 512 MB single DDR PC2100 chip and a Diamond Viper 550 -> Nvidia TNT2 -> Geforce 2 MX 200 , always rock solid ;o). From the beginning with Windows 98 SE -> Windows XP prof.
Had some problems with the Radeon 9000 Pro but replaced that for an Nvidia FX5200 with 128 MB running at AGP 4x. And it's stable again....

By the way I have never used the overclocking functions ;o)


Good product. period.
